| If the game ends
in a tie at the end of regulation time, the following procedure will be used: |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
| 1) Two (2)
complete extra time periods shall be played as follows: U10 -- 5 minutes; U12 -- 7 minutes; U14 -- 9 minutes |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
| 2) If a team is
playing short because of ejections, they will continue to play short during
the extra time periods. |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
| 3) At the end of
the first extra time period, the teams switch ends of the field and
immediately begin the second extra period with a kickoff. |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
| 4) If one team
is ahead at the end of the second extra time period, that team shall be
declared the winner. Otherwise,
proceed with step (5). |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
| 5) In the case
of a tie at the end of the two extra periods, the winner shall be determined
by the taking of penalty kicks as described in (8) and (9). Only the players on the field at the |
| termination of
the 2nd extra time period may take penalty kicks. No player may be exempted from taking a
kick. The goalkeeper may be changed
with any player on the field before any |
| penalty kick. A
goalkeeper who is injured while kicks are being taken from the penalty mark
and is unable to continue as goalkeeper may be replaced by a substitute (not
on the field). |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
| 6) If a team is
playing short at the end of the second overtime period because of ejections,
the other team will reduce its number to equate to that of the team with
fewer players. |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
| 7) The referee
chooses the goal at which the kicks will be taken. The referee tosses a coin and the team
whose captain wins the toss decides whether to take the first or second kick. |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
| 8) Each team
shall alternately take five (5) penalty kicks at the same goal; each one
shall be taken by a different player; the team scoring the most goals shall
be declared the winner. |
| If, before both
teams have taken five kicks, one has scored more goals than the other could
score, even if it were to complete its five kicks, no more kicks are taken. |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
| 9) If a tie
still exists after (8) has been completed, the taking of penalty kicks shall
continue in the same order, each kick being taken by a different player,
until such time as both teams |
| have taken an
equal number of kicks and one team has scored one goal more than the
other. This team shall be declared the
winner. |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
| 10) If all
players of each team on the field at the end of the 2nd extra time period
have been used and the match is still tied, the taking of penalty kicks shall
continue repeating step (9) |
| until a winner
is declared. |
